This stunning dress from bridal designer Bowen Dryden is universally flattering with its empire line and flutter sleeves.
The bodice has pale pink, pale green and white embroidery, which can complement your flowers! The back of the bodies is lace only.

Modifications made by seamstress:
1. Skirt length (reaches the floor on 166cm bride wearing 9cm heels)
2. Bust cups sewn in for extra support
3. Empire line lace band trim sewn down to prevent from rolling over
4. Invisible lining of shoulder/armpit seams to prevent rubbing
5. Bustle loops sewn in for train when you hit the dance floor!
